Abstract

In Storage Services, Deduplication is used to reduce the data size by eliminating storage of duplicate data. Deduplication is an effective data reduction technique to minimize the storage cost as well as communication cost. However, Deduplication raises significant security issues. Malicious users and semi-trusted Storage Server tries to learn the data outsourced by other users. Encrypting the data at user side before uploading to Storage Server is essential for protecting outsourced data. However, conventional deterministic encryption techniques are vulnerable to brute-force attacks and dictionary attacks for predictable files. In this paper, we propose secure random key based encryption technique for Deduplicated Storage. In our approach, user encrypts the file with a randomly chosen key. Random key is encrypted by set of hash values generated from plaintext file. In this way, our approach provides protection against brute-force attack and dictionary attack. We analyze security of our approach with theoretical proof and experimental analysis.
